What is a Fiata Bill of lading?

The FIATA Bill of Lading acts as a shipping contract as well as a confirmation that the products have been transported via more than one method of transportation, according to the International Maritime Organization. The liability of the freight forwarder is also determined by this clause.

What is fiata diploma?

The FIATA Diploma in Freight Forwarding is comprised of 14 modules that cover all of the important issues for freight forwarders, such as multimodal transportation, air transportation, customs processes, and the use of information and communication technology in the freight forwarding industry.

How do I become a freight forwarder in Canada?

To apply to the CBSA to become a non-bonded air or rail carrier or freight forwarder, you must meet the following requirements: Fill out the appropriate application form, which is as follows: With the Canada Border Services Agency, you must file Form BSF329-1, Application to Transact Air Operations.With the Canada Border Services Agency, you must submit a BSF329-5 application to conduct rail operations.
